Workpiece registration help
Hi – I’m after a bit of help…
I am looking into the possibility of getting a laser cutter/engraver tool (something like a Versalaser) to be used to manufacture ultrasonic transducers. The tool would be put to use for a few applications, from cutting stencils out of adhesive backed films to laser ablating unwanted material from silver loaded epoxy films.
The big question I have is are there any tools with an optical system for aligning / registering the workpiece to the laser to give accurate alignment such that the beam can be used to make features at exact positions (+/- 0.01mm). I suspect that the manufacturing tolerances of our substrates will not allow a piece to be positioned in a per-determined place such that the beam will cut in the same position as say it did to the one before. I feel that each piece needs to be aligned individually, hence the need for a camera system.
